West Elm is a prominent brand in the contemporary home furnishings market, known for its unique blend of modern design, affordability, and commitment to ethical and sustainable production. Founded in 2002 and headquartered in Brooklyn, New York, West Elm quickly became a household name, offering a wide range of furniture, bedding, rugs, lighting, and decorative accessories. The brand is a subsidiary of Williams-Sonoma, Inc., and has gained popularity for its distinctive style that combines modern aesthetics with an organic and handcrafted touch.

A defining feature of West Elm is its commitment to sustainability and social responsibility. The brand has initiatives in place to use more sustainable materials like FSC-certified wood and organic cotton, and to support ethical labor practices. They also collaborate with local artisans and craft communities around the world, promoting handcrafted products under their label. This approach not only provides unique, high-quality products to consumers but also supports traditional craftsmanship and sustainable practices globally.
